Taxonomic Classification

Rank Andean Caenolestid brackish river prawn
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Malacostraca (Crustaceans)
Order Paucituberculata (Paucituberculata) Decapoda (Decapoda)
Family Caenolestidae Palaemonidae
Genus Caenolestes Macrobrachium
Species Caenolestes condorensis Macrobrachium macrobrachion

Evolutionary Relationship

Andean Caenolestid and brackish river prawn share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
